2011 Mazda 3 FAQ

What is the fuel consumption of a 2011 Mazda 3 in Australia?

The 2011 Mazda 3 has an average fuel consumption of approximately 6.8 L/100 km for combined city and highway driving, which is efficient for a vehicle in its class and based on Australian testing standards.

What are the main features of each 2011 Mazda 3 variant available in Australia?

In Australia, the 2011 Mazda 3 was offered in several variants, including the Maxx, Touring, and Mazda 3 SP25. The base Maxx variant features a 2.0L four-cylinder engine producing 114kW, along with standard equipment like air conditioning, remote locking, and a four-speaker audio system. Moving up to the Touring adds comfort features such as fog lights, a leather-wrapped steering wheel, and upgraded interior trim. The SP25, being the sportier option, comes with a more powerful 2.5L engine generating 138kW, sportier styling elements, and technology enhancements like a six-speaker audio system and Bluetooth connectivity. All variants offer good reliability, fuel economy ranging from 6.7 to 8.0 L/100km, and have a strong reputation for low maintenance costs, making them popular choices among Australian car buyers.

How does the 2011 Mazda 3 compare to other models in its category?

In comparison to other compact cars, the 2011 Mazda 3 stands out with its sporty handling and responsive steering. It generally offers better driving dynamics compared to competitors like the Toyota Corolla and Honda Civic, making it a popular choice among driving enthusiasts.

What is the reliability rating of a 2011 Mazda 3?

The 2011 Mazda 3 has a strong reputation for reliability, often scoring high in various consumer reliability surveys. Owners frequently report fewer issues compared to other vehicles in the same category, making it a dependable option for drivers.

What are the maintenance costs of a 2011 Mazda 3?

Maintenance costs for the 2011 Mazda 3 tend to be reasonable, with regular services averaging around AUD 300 to AUD 500 per year, depending on usage and service intervals. Parts availability is also good, which helps keep repair costs manageable.
